William R. Morrison

Bill Morrison is a fourth generation Hamiltonian, born and raised in the city. He received his B.A. from McMaster in 1963 and his M.A. in 1964. He taught high school for a year, earned a PhD from the University of Western Ontario, worked briefly for the federal government, then taught at Brandon University, Lakehead University, and the University of Northern British Columbia, where he was the first Dean of Research and Graduate Studies. He also taught sessionally at the University of Victoria and Duke University.

In 2007 he was awarded an Honorary D.Lit. by Brandon University. He is editor, author and co-author of thirteen books, most recently Campus Confidential: 100 Startling Things You Don’t Know About Canada’s Universities, second edition James Lorimer 2013. Retired in 2010 after 41 years of university teaching and administration, he lives with his wife in Ladysmith, BC.
